Fix SF hint sessions for virtual multi-display case

Currently timing for hint sessions in SurfaceFlinger do not work for
multi-display case with virtual displays (eg: Android Auto). This
patch fixes that by tracking true sf present completion time to
supplement hwc time tracking in the sf main thread deadline case.
